你查询的IP:[116.4.245.137]  地理位置:中国–广东–东莞

最新查询134.196.54.81 117.40.68.147 121.248.223.87 119.108.123.236 60.247.219.131 202.70.131.3 121.60.63.206 114.68.232.103 220.192.160.190 116.4.245.137 123.108.208.230 119.40.54.35 202.122.32.243 218.185.192.166 119.18.192.35 121.56.186.109 58.24.144.239 210.72.44.222 220.234.167.74 123.152.128.228 120.32.142.248 117.64.185.59 120.137.2.244 118.102.16.85 117.48.211.101 202.142.16.224 121.224.59.76 118.224.36.20 119.40.64.149 198.17.7.200 202.127.112.174